About Gregory E. Wilding

Gregory E. Wilding is a scholar working on Surgery, Gastroenterology, Infectious Diseases, Molecular Biology and Oncology, having authored 35 papers that have together received 609 indexed citations. Recurring topics across this work include Gastrointestinal motility and disorders (11 papers), Surgical Simulation and Training (4 papers), Bladder and Urothelial Cancer Treatments (3 papers), HIV/AIDS drug development and treatment (2 papers), Congenital gastrointestinal and neural anomalies (2 papers), Clinical Nutrition and Gastroenterology (2 papers), Venous Thromboembolism Diagnosis and Management (1 paper) and Global Health and Surgery (1 paper). The work is most often cited by research in Gastroenterology (192 citations), Transplantation (14 citations), Surgery (220 citations), Toxicology (16 citations) and Internal Medicine (11 citations). Gregory E. Wilding has collaborated with scholars based in United States, Italy and Vietnam. Frequent co-authors include William L. Hasler, Richard J. Saad, Satish S.C. Rao, William D. Chey, Michael D. Sitrin, John K. DiBaise, Jeffrey M. Lackner, Braden Kuo, Richard W. McCallum and Jack Semler. Their work appears in journals such as Gastroenterology, The Journal of Urology, Journal of neurosurgery, Cancer Epidemiology Biomarkers & Prevention and Therapeutic Drug Monitoring.
